The Portuguese term casa de campo literally translates to 'house of country' or more naturally in English, a 'country house.' However, the cultural weight of this term extends far beyond a simple architectural description. In the Lusophone world, particularly in Portugal and Brazil, a casa de campo represents an aspirational lifestyle, a sanctuary from the frantic pace of urban centers like Lisbon, Porto, São Paulo, or Rio de Janeiro. It is the physical manifestation of 'sossego' (tranquility) and 'descanso' (rest). Historically, these houses were often ancestral homes or working farmhouses, but in the modern era, they have transitioned into weekend retreats and luxury vacation rentals. When a Portuguese speaker mentions their casa de campo, they are not just talking about a building; they are talking about a specific atmosphere involving the smell of wet earth, the sound of cicadas, and the tradition of long, slow meals shared with extended family under the shade of a porch or a large tree.
- Geographic Nuance
- In Portugal, a casa de campo might be a rustic stone cottage in the northern Minho region or a whitewashed, blue-trimmed 'monte' in the southern Alentejo. In Brazil, while the term is used, you will often hear 'sítio' or 'chácara' for smaller rural properties, whereas 'casa de campo' remains the more formal and descriptive term for the residence itself.
People use this term most frequently when discussing vacation plans, real estate investments, or childhood memories. It is a term deeply rooted in the concept of the 'interior' (the countryside). Unlike a 'casa de praia' (beach house), which implies activity, sun, and socializing, the casa de campo is associated with introspection, reading, gardening, and 'fogo de lareira' (fireplace fire). It is the setting for many classic Portuguese novels, where the contrast between the corrupting city and the purifying countryside is a recurring theme. In the context of modern tourism, 'Turismo de Habitação' and 'Turismo Rural' are industries built entirely around the allure of the casa de campo, offering travelers a chance to experience traditional Portuguese hospitality in a pastoral setting.
Muitas famílias portuguesas passam os meses de verão na sua casa de campo para fugir ao calor da cidade.
Furthermore, the term carries a certain social status. Owning a casa de campo suggests a level of financial stability that allows for the maintenance of a second home dedicated solely to leisure. It is also a place where traditions are preserved; it is where the family might make their own olive oil, harvest grapes for wine, or bake bread in a traditional wood-fired oven ('forno a lenha'). This connection to the land is a vital part of the Portuguese identity, even for those who have lived in cities for generations. The casa de campo serves as a bridge to the past, a place where the rhythm of life is dictated by the seasons rather than by a clock or a smartphone screen. Whether it is a grand manor house (solar) or a humble cottage, the essence remains the same: a return to roots and a slower pace of existence.

Using casa de campo in a sentence requires an understanding of its role as a compound noun. Grammatically, 'casa' is the head noun, and 'de campo' is a prepositional phrase acting as an adjective. This means that any modifications for number (pluralization) happen to the word 'casa'. For example, 'uma casa de campo' (one country house) becomes 'duas casas de campo' (two country houses). The word 'campo' stays singular because it describes the type or location of the houses. When using articles, 'casa' is feminine, so you use 'a', 'uma', 'esta', or 'aquela'.
- Verbal Pairings
- Common verbs used with this term include: 'alugar' (to rent), 'comprar' (to buy), 'vender' (to sell), 'reformar' (to renovate), 'visitar' (to visit), and 'herdar' (to inherit).
When talking about location, we use the preposition 'em' combined with the article. 'Eu estou na casa de campo' (I am at the country house). If you are moving toward it, you use 'para': 'Nós vamos para a casa de campo amanhã' (We are going to the country house tomorrow). It is also very common to use descriptive adjectives to specify the state or style of the house, such as 'rústica' (rustic), 'luxuosa' (luxurious), 'isolada' (isolated), or 'acolhedora' (cozy). Notice that these adjectives must agree in gender with 'casa', which is feminine.
Eles decidiram alugar uma casa de campo rústica para celebrar o aniversário de casamento.
In more complex sentence structures, 'casa de campo' can serve as the subject or the object. For instance, 'A casa de campo da minha avó foi construída há cem anos' (My grandmother's country house was built a hundred years ago). Here, the entire phrase acts as the subject. In the sentence 'Eu adoro o silêncio da casa de campo', it is part of a genitive construction showing possession or characteristic. It is also important to note that in Portuguese, we often omit the possessive pronoun if the context is clear, but with 'casa de campo', people often specify whose it is because it is a significant asset.
Another common way to use the phrase is in the context of comparisons. You might hear someone say, 'A vida na cidade é estressante, prefiro mil vezes a minha casa de campo.' This highlights the emotional preference for the rural setting. In writing, especially in literature or travel journalism, you will see 'casa de campo' surrounded by sensory language—words describing the 'paisagem' (landscape), 'ar puro' (fresh air), 'pomar' (orchard), and 'horta' (vegetable garden). These elements are considered inseparable from the concept of the house itself.
- Prepositional Usage
- 'De' vs 'No': Use 'casa de campo' as the name of the object, but 'casa no campo' to emphasize the location specifically (a house in the country).
Gostaria de ter uma casa de campo com uma lareira grande para o inverno.
Finally, consider the register of your sentence. In formal settings, such as a legal document or a formal invitation, 'casa de campo' is used precisely. In informal conversation, it might be shortened simply to 'o campo' (the country) if the context of the house is already established. For example, 'Vou para o campo este fim de semana' implies going to one's country house. However, for clarity and richness of language, using the full phrase 'casa de campo' is always preferred when describing the specific dwelling.
You will encounter the phrase casa de campo in a variety of real-world scenarios, ranging from casual conversations to professional industries. One of the most common places is in the **real estate market** (mercado imobiliário). Websites like Idealista in Portugal or Zap Imóveis in Brazil have dedicated categories for 'casas de campo' or 'imóveis rurais.' Here, the term is used to attract buyers looking for secondary residences or investment properties for rural tourism. You will hear agents describe the 'potencial de renovação' (renovation potential) or the 'vista desafogada' (unobstructed view) of a casa de campo.
- Media and Entertainment
- In Portuguese soap operas (telenovelas), the 'casa de campo' is a classic trope. It is often the place where characters go to hide, have secret affairs, or where the wealthy patriarch lives in seclusion.
In **travel and tourism**, the term is ubiquitous. Magazines like 'Evasões' or 'Viagens e Lazer' frequently feature articles on the 'Melhores Casas de Campo para um Fim de Semana Romântico' (Best Country Houses for a Romantic Weekend). In this context, the term implies a certain level of boutique comfort, often involving breakfast with local products, infinity pools overlooking vineyards, and high-quality interior design that blends modern amenities with rustic charm. If you are booking a stay on platforms like Airbnb or Booking.com in a Portuguese-speaking country, 'casa de campo' is the filter you would use to find these experiences.
Vi um anúncio de uma casa de campo maravilhosa no Douro para alugar nas férias.
In **literature and music**, the concept is deeply poetic. The famous Brazilian singer Elis Regina has a song titled 'Casa no Campo' (a slight variation), which expresses the universal desire to leave the city behind and live a simple life: 'Eu quero uma casa no campo / Onde eu possa compor muitos roques rurais.' This song solidified the 'casa de campo' as a symbol of freedom and artistic inspiration for an entire generation. Similarly, in Portuguese literature, writers like Eça de Queirós often used country estates (often called 'quintas' or 'solares,' which are types of casas de campo) as settings to critique the social dynamics of the 19th century.
Finally, you will hear this in **everyday social life**. On a Monday morning in an office in Lisbon, a colleague might say, 'O meu fim de semana foi ótimo, estive na casa de campo dos meus pais e não fiz nada a não ser comer e dormir.' Here, it is used to signal a successful recharge of energy. It is a term of comfort, indicating a place where the social masks of the city can be dropped. Whether it's a discussion about inheritance, a plan for a summer barbecue, or a dream for retirement, 'casa de campo' is a constant presence in the Lusophone linguistic landscape.

One of the most frequent mistakes English speakers make when using casa de campo is confusing it with other rural terms like 'fazenda', 'sítio', or 'chácara'. While they all relate to the countryside, they are not interchangeable. A **fazenda** is a large-scale farm or ranch, usually focusing on commercial agriculture or livestock. Calling a modest weekend cottage a 'fazenda' would sound like an exaggeration. Conversely, calling a massive cattle ranch a 'casa de campo' would be an understatement, as it ignores the economic function of the land.
- Regional Confusion
- In Brazil, 'sítio' is the most common word for a small country house with some land. If you use 'casa de campo' in a very casual Brazilian setting, it might sound a bit formal or 'chic', whereas 'sítio' is the everyday term.
Another common error is the literal translation of 'country house' without the preposition 'de'. Students often try to say 'casa campo' or 'campo casa'. In Portuguese, nouns usually require a preposition to connect them when one describes the other. The 'de' is essential because it establishes the relationship of 'belonging' to the category of the countryside. Similarly, avoid using 'casa nacional' or 'casa rural' as direct replacements for 'casa de campo' in casual speech; while 'rural' is a valid adjective, it sounds more technical or bureaucratic.
Incorreto: Eu comprei uma casa campo.
Correto: Eu comprei uma casa de campo.
Grammatically, gender and number agreement is a stumbling block. Remember that 'casa' is feminine. Therefore, any adjectives must end in '-a' (if they follow the standard rule). Saying 'uma casa de campo bonito' is incorrect; it must be 'uma casa de campo bonita.' The adjective 'bonita' modifies 'casa', not 'campo'. Likewise, for plurals, only 'casa' changes: 'as casas de campo'. Many learners mistakenly try to pluralize 'campo' as well, saying 'casas de campos', which changes the meaning to 'houses of fields,' which sounds odd.
There is also a prepositional nuance between 'casa de campo' and 'casa no campo'. While often used interchangeably, 'casa de campo' refers to the *style* and *type* of house (a country-style house), whereas 'casa no campo' literally means a 'house [located] in the country.' If you are describing your property's features, 'de campo' is better. If you are describing its location on a map, 'no campo' is more precise. However, using 'no' when you mean 'de' is a minor error compared to the others mentioned.
- Spelling Note
- Before the 1990 Orthographic Agreement, some compound words had hyphens. Now, 'casa de campo' has no hyphen. Using one (casa-de-campo) is an outdated spelling mistake.
Erro comum: As casas de campos são caras.
Correto: As casas de campo são caras.
Finally, be careful with the word 'country' in English. In English, 'country' can mean 'nation' (país) or 'rural area' (campo). In Portuguese, 'casa de país' makes no sense. Always ensure you are translating the concept of the rural landscape, not the political entity. If you keep these distinctions in mind—especially the difference between a house, a farm, and a ranch—you will sound much more like a native speaker.
The Portuguese language is rich with terms for rural dwellings, each carrying a slightly different nuance depending on size, purpose, and region. Understanding these alternatives will allow you to be much more precise in your descriptions. The most common alternative to casa de campo in Portugal is **quinta**. A quinta is historically a farm property that paid one-fifth (quinto) of its produce to the landlord. Today, it refers to a country estate, often with a large house, gardens, and agricultural land (like a vineyard). If a casa de campo is particularly grand, it's a quinta.
- Comparison: Casa de Campo vs. Sítio
- A 'casa de campo' focuses on the building and the leisure aspect. A 'sítio' (common in Brazil) implies a small plot of land used for subsistence or weekend fun, often including a pool and a small orchard.
In Brazil, you will also hear the term **chácara**. This is very similar to a 'sítio' but is usually located closer to the city limits, making it a popular choice for 'chácaras de eventos' (event venues) or quick weekend getaways. If you move up in scale, you find the **fazenda**. As mentioned in the common mistakes section, a fazenda is a large ranch. In the south of Brazil and in Uruguay/Argentina (as 'estancia'), the term **estância** is used for these large cattle-rearing estates. In Portugal, the equivalent of a large southern estate (especially in Alentejo) is a **herdade**.
Enquanto uma casa de campo pode ser apenas para férias, uma fazenda é uma unidade de produção agrícola.
For smaller, more specific types of houses, you might use **chalé**. This term, borrowed from the French 'chalet', usually describes a wooden or stone house with a sloped roof, common in mountainous regions like the Serra da Estrela in Portugal or Campos do Jordão in Brazil. It implies a 'cozy' or 'alpine' vibe. Another term is **cabana** (cabin), which suggests something much simpler and more rustic, perhaps even primitive. If you are talking about a very large, noble country house with historical significance, the word **solar** is appropriate. A solar is often an ancestral manor house belonging to an aristocratic family.
If you are looking for more modern or descriptive alternatives, you could use **vivenda rural** (rural villa) or **retiro** (retreat). 'Retiro' is particularly useful when you want to emphasize the house as a place of spiritual or mental escape. In the context of tourism, you might see **alojamento local** (local lodging), which is the legal term for many casas de campo used as rentals. Finally, for a very small, often one-room stone hut used by shepherds, the term is **cabana de pedra** or **abrigo**.
- Comparison: Quinta vs. Herdade
- 'Quinta' is more common in Northern and Central Portugal. 'Herdade' is the term of choice in the Alentejo for vast properties.
Eles preferiram comprar um chalé na montanha do que uma casa de campo no vale.
By choosing between 'casa de campo', 'quinta', 'sítio', 'fazenda', or 'chalé', you convey not just the location, but the size, the economic status, and the intended use of the property. For a general, safe, and always correct term for a house in a rural setting, 'casa de campo' remains your best choice.
